I want to backup my disk with all of its contents. Exactly, I want to copy
it completely to another disk.
I have only one freebsd partition and several slices on my disk. I want to
copy all the data to another bigger disk preserving my user and group
settings.
Is it possible to use "cp"? In this way I supposed to create my partitions
before and mount them under some partition and just "cp -Rp / /newdisk" but
Won't it start to copy the data recursively when copying reachs /newdisk?
